HIGHLAND MAIN STREET

Formed in 2011, Highland Main Street (HMS) restores, revitalizes and promotes the downtown district of Highland, Indiana. Using a focus on structures, attractions, business and landscape, HMS serves as a catalyst to make the downtown district stronger and more vibrant for residents, visitors and business owners in the area. Click here to learn more about the duties of the Highland Main Street Bureau.


Commercial Property Improvement Grant

The Commercial Property Improvement Grant Program encourages property/business owners to renovate, restore and improve buildings – both inside and out. Grants will be awarded for up to 25 percent of the approved total. Projects over $20,000 will take priority, however, the Redevelopment Commission will review all projects regardless of the amount requested. Click here to download application. Questions? Downtown Restaurant Crawl

Join us for our monthly Downtown Restaurant Crawl from 4-8 p.m. the last Tuesday of month in downtown Highland. Participating restaurants feature a special for $7 or less, so that visitors can “eat their way through downtown,” stopping at their usual haunts and discovering new favorites along the way. Several businesses will also be open late.
